Transaction 151d1a04c19d589b045956911659da678fab2b1dc101e283757f16b987d4012e
1 Input
1 Output
-
151d1a04c19d589b045956911659da678fab2b1dc101e283757f16b987d4012e:0
- value
- 5804991
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52bb3b33ae4f73664372ebc5b7cad84e3bfff60f OP_EQUAL
- address
- 39ETdL5GeRKeNxWoDJmq4tPyNy11pPucFn